
"Disney's Language: Celebrating 100 Years of Magic and Surprises"
As Disney celebrates its 100th anniversary, its status as a generation-spanning cultural force is no longer certain. Once known for creating a modern shared language and a set of reference points recognizable to almost everyone, Disney now faces challenges in a fractured cultural landscape. The company's rigid brand management and resistance to evolving its language hinder its ability to adapt to the changing times. The rise of the internet, streaming, and digital era has further contributed to the erosion of Disney's dominance as a monoculture. While still the most dominant entertainment company in Hollywood, Disney's recent relative flops and struggles at the box office highlight the need for a more realistic approach. The studio's ability to capture imagination across generations and propose its own way of seeing the world is being challenged, and it remains to be seen if Disney can maintain its cultural influence in the future.
